A perfect operator consistently demonstrates professionalism, responsibility, and a positive attitude. They perform thorough pre-trip inspections, maintain a clean and safe vehicle, and follow all traffic regulations. Effective communication with students, parents, and school officials is essential. The perfect operator remains calm under pressure, makes sound decisions, and prioritizes the safety of every passenger. By embodying these qualities, school bus drivers set a high standard for safety, reliability, and trust, ensuring a safe journey for all students.
